
Lokacin da kuka ji 'kayan safa na jirgin ƙasa', yawancin mutanen da ke wajen masana'antar suna ɗaukar sassauƙan kayan aikin da ba na kan-shirya ba-a kusoshi, injin wanki, ƙila kushin birki. Wannan shine kuskuren farko. A hakikanin gaskiya, duniya ce da aka siffanta ta hanyar zagayowar damuwa, matsananciyar yanayi, da wa'adin da ba za a iya sasantawa ba na tsawon rai. Ajiye ba guntun karfe ba ne kawai; yanki ne da aka tabbatar da amincin tsarin. Kalubale na gaske yana farawa lokacin da kuke buƙatar samo ko ƙera wanda ya dace da aikin na asali, ba kawai girmansa ba. Wannan rata tsakanin zane da aiki, abin dogara shine inda shekarun da suka gabata na ganowa da ƙwarewar injina suna da mahimmanci.
Ba za ku iya dogaro da injina cikin sashe ba idan simintin ɗin ya yi kuskure daga farko. Domin abubuwan da suka shafi layin dogo, musamman ma waɗanda ke ɗauke da kaya ko kuma ke da hannu a guntuwa da dakatarwa, hanyar simintin gyare-gyare na da mahimmanci. Mun yi nisa fiye da ainihin simintin yashi don sassa masu mahimmanci. Ɗauki wani abu kamar daftarin mahalli ko ɓangaren ma'aurata. Matsi na ciki daga sanyi mara kyau ko ƙazanta na iya haifar da gazawar bala'i a ƙarƙashin hawan keke. Shi ya sa saboda yawancin waɗannan sassa, mu a QSY mun dogara sosai harsashi mold simintin gyaran kafa kuma zuba jari. Kwanciyar kwanciyar hankali da ƙoƙarce-ƙoƙarce saman ba wai kawai don kamanni ba ne; suna rage lokacin injina kuma suna ba da madaidaicin matrix kayan aiki daga tafiya.
Zaɓin kayan abu wani Layer ne. Ba karfe kawai ba. Shin don aikace-aikacen sawa ne kamar ɓangaren diski na birki? Kuna kallon takamaiman maki na simintin ƙarfe ko ƙarfe mai zafi. Don abubuwan da ke kusa da wheelset da ke hulɗa da tasiri da abrasion, watakila karfen manganese. Muna da aikin wani ɓangaren ɗaukar kaya na gefen mota. Samfurin farko a cikin daidaitaccen ƙarfe na carbon ya gaza gwajin gajiya da ban mamaki- ya fashe a tushen bayan ɗan juzu'in da ake buƙata. Komawa allon zane. Mun canza zuwa ƙananan ƙarfe mai ƙarancin ƙarfe tare da takamaiman tsari na quenching da tempering. Bambancin ba kawai a kan takarda ba; kana iya ganin tsarin hatsi ya fi ƙarfi, ya fi uniform. Wannan bangare daga karshe ya wuce. Darasi? Abubuwan da ke kan bugu shine kawai wurin farawa; tsarin tushe yana bayyana ruhinsa.

Yin simintin gyare-gyare yana samun 90% a can. Kashi 10% na ƙarshe-machining- shine inda ɓangaren ke samun sunansa azaman haƙiƙa na gaske. Fuskar hawan da ke kashe da ƴan kashi goma na millimeter na iya nufin rashin daidaituwa, lalacewa da wuri, ko rashin dacewa yayin kulawa. Don aikace-aikacen layin dogo, injinan CNC ba kayan alatu ba ne; shi ne tushe. Muna magana ne game da tsarin ramin rami a kan firam ɗin bogie, daidaitattun wuraren zama a kan axles, ko hadaddun kwandon shara. dunƙulen ma'aurata.
Hirar da kuke gani a wasu lokuta akan layi game da mashin ɗin CNC sau da yawa yakan rasa ma'anar sassan masana'antu masu nauyi. Ba wai kawai samun injina ba ne (ko da yake wannan yana da mahimmanci), amma game da riƙon aiki da dabarun kayan aiki don yawancin manyan simintin gyare-gyare na yau da kullun. Machining wani m aluminum braket abu daya ne; Rike da simintin karfe 200kg don tsarin tsarin birki da tsayin daka don cimma kyakkyawan yanayin gamawa da juriya na matsayi wani dabba ne gaba daya. Vibration shine abokan gaba. Mun koyi wannan hanya mai wuya tun da wuri, ƙoƙarin ɓata lokaci akan ƙirar ƙira don jerin hanyoyin haɗin gwiwa. Sakamakon ya kasance batch tare da madaidaicin madaidaicin maɓalli. Tsara. Gyaran ya kasance al'ada, na'ura mai mahimmanci na hydraulic mai yawa wanda ya fi tsada amma ya kawar da bambancin.

Duk da yake yawancin abubuwan da aka gyara suna cikin nau'o'i daban-daban na karfe da ƙarfe, mai ban sha'awa-kuma sau da yawa mafi kalubale-aiki yana zuwa tare da gami na musamman. Yi tunani game da abubuwan da aka haɗa a cikin yanayin zafi mai zafi ko ɓatacce sosai akan locomotives na zamani, ko sassan da ke fama da matsanancin lalacewa. Anan shine nickel tushen gami ko cobalt na tushen gami shigo ciki.
Mun sami bincike sau ɗaya don ƙaramin ɓangaren bawul amma mai mahimmanci da aka yi amfani da shi a cikin tsarin taimakon injin dizal akan jirgin ƙasa. Yanayin ya kasance mai zafi kuma an fallasa shi ga abubuwan da suka lalace. Bakin karfe 316 bai yanke shi ba; yana lalata da kamawa. Maganin da aka gabatar shine gami da tushen nickel, Inconel 625. Kama? Machinability yana da muni. Yana aiki-tauri nan take, yana cin kayan aiki don karin kumallo, kuma yana buƙatar takamaiman saurin gudu, ciyarwa, da dabarun sanyaya. Babban misali ne na inda ƙwararrun kayan aiki daga ɓangaren tushe dole ne su sanar da aikin injin. Ba za ku iya kawai jefa daidaitaccen shirin CNC a ciki ba. Haɗin gwiwa tsakanin mai sarrafa ƙarfe da gubar injin ɗin ya zama mahimmanci.

Ba wanda yake son yin magana game da gazawar, amma su ne mafi kyawun malamai. A cikin kayayyakin kayan aikin jirgin kasa kasuwanci, gazawa a fagen rikici ne, amma gazawar gwaji shine bayanai. Na tuna da wani harka tare da sabon samo asali na gefe shock absorber sashi ga kocin fasinja. Ya wuce duk gwaje-gwajen nauyi a tsaye amma ya kasa yin gwajin gajiya mai ƙarfi. Fuskar karaya ta nuna farkon gazawar gazawa a wani kusurwoyi mai kaifi na ciki-mai tashin hankali wanda ba ya bayyana akan zanen.
Gyaran ba kawai don sanya sashin yayi kauri ba. Ya haɗa da sake tsarawa don ƙara radius na fillet a cikin simintin gyare-gyare, canji ga mold, da kuma nazarin yanayin yanayin zafi don inganta ƙarfin a cikin takamaiman sashe. Mai ba da kayayyaki na asali ba zai iya sarrafa wannan tushen tushen bincike da tsarin sake tsarawa ba; sun kasance kawai masana'antar kantin kayan aiki suna aiki daga bugawa.
